WebThe Freiris of Berwik has been very often published, at first usually attributed to William Dunbar, and appears in the following important editions that are particularly early, … WebTHE FREIRIS OF BERWIK.—Page 3. N printing this very admirableTale from Maitlands MS., MrPinkerton, in 1786, was thefirst to ascribe its compositionto Dunbar. It is also preservedin Bannatynes MS., and in anEdition printed at Aberdeen, in162-2; but in these copies it is. also anonymous. This admirable Tale the Editor (Pinkerton) sup-poses to ... WebThe plot begins with two friars, old Allane and younger Robert, returning home to Berwick after an excursion into the countryside, and seeking lodging at the house of Symon Lawrear when night approaches while they are still well outside the town walls. organon asmanex
